Government, Mayor, Provincial Governors Discuss Issues Of National Importance

Government cabinet and Vientiane Mayor and provincial governors have agreed to turn the Prime Minister’s draft order on the implementation of the socio-economic development plan, financial plan and monetary plan for 2017 into a Prime Minister’s Decree.
The enlarged meeting between the government cabinet and Vientiane Mayor and provincial governors was told yesterday that the upgrading of the legal instrument was to ensure it was in line with the Law on Investment Promotion.
At the meeting, Prime Minister Thongloun assigned the Ministry of Finance to work with relevant ministries and government organisations at central and local levels to evaluate the payment of obligations, revenue collection management, and expenditure plan implementation, and promote the application of modern technology to the revenue collection to ensure the transparency of relevant sectors.
The government has urged relevant sectors to make sure they can pay civil servants’ salary of the last month of 2016 by the end of this year and the payment of civil servants’ salary for the next fiscal year must be made systematically and in line with established rules.
The participants of the meeting reached an agreement to continue implementing the Prime Minister’s Order No. 15 on Enhancing Strictness on the Management and Inspection of Timber Exploitation, Timber Movement and Timber Business.
They asked the Ministry of Industry and Commerce to work with all relevant sectors at central and local levels to attach greater importance to controlling goods prices so that impacts on the living conditions of consumers, especially civil servants and low income families are minimised.
The government has assigned the Ministry of Finance to come up with proper measures to promote thriftiness and anti-extravagant lifestyle in the society, and asked the Ministry of Education and Sports and the Ministry of Information, Culture and Tourism to attach greater importance to the management of restaurants and entrainment venues located in prohibited areas.
The participants of the meeting were reported about the progress in the implementation of the Laos-China Railway project and the Lao-Thai railway project phase II. They expressed their recognition of the importance of the two development projects to the socio-economic development in the country and urged the Ministry of Public Works and Transport to deliberate on the recommendations on the two projects that the participants made at the meeting.
